The design is simplicity itself; a circle of stainless steel, covered with black oxide, with a small gap at the bottom and a tab next to it. The basic function is simple; slide your belt loop through the gap and you’ve instantly got your keys hooked to your waist. As an added advantage, this makes them hard to swipe unless you happen to run into an experienced pickpocket. As for the tab next to the gap, well, you really can’t ask anybody to put anything on their keychain these days if it doesn’t open bottles. Hence, the Black Key Ring is also a bottle opener.

Belted

black-key-ring-2It also has the added advantage of being utterly indestructible. It’s machined entirely from one piece of solid stainless steel before the black oxide is applied to it, and you can get it without the oxide or in brass if you’d prefer. So, even if you beat the complete and total crap out of it in day to day use, you’re unlikely to cause any actual damage, making it ideal for people who usually break keychain charms.
